Story:

Members of the RMT union on the Victoria Line walked out in a 24-hour-strike over the sacking of a driver. He was fired - after opening the doors in a station on the wrong side. The union say they're striking over safety - as the Victoria Line is the only one with trains that can open doors on the wrong side. But tube bosses claim the driver put passengers at risk and tried to cover it up.
